About the Role

Our client is on the market to add a Regional Plant Controller to their team. The Regional Plant Controller serves as a key financial partner to plant management, providing strategic insights and analysis to drive operational efficiency and cost improvements. This role is responsible for overseeing all aspects of plant financial performance, including cost analysis, budgeting, forecasting, and reporting, while ensuring compliance with accounting standards and company policies.

Responsibilities

  • The role will have office locations in both Tupelo and Baldwyn, MS.
  • Partner with plant management to analyze cost variances, expenditures, material losses, and labor utilization while identifying opportunities to improve results
  • Responsible for understanding all manufacturing costs, managing bill of materials, reviewing all cost variances
  • Work with Plant Management in analyzing cost variances and potential areas of opportunity
  • Review plant performance on a weekly basis with management and provide financial analysis of variances
  • Prepare monthly executive level financial reports
  • Assist with monthly financial close activities and other reporting/ad hoc analyses
  • Prepare annual budget and monthly forecast for plants and assist with plant capital projects as needed
  • Work with plant-on-plant related inventory, accounting and SAP processes
  • Crosstrain with other plant finance functions in the management of the bill of material process and assist and partner with business leaders on implementation of cost improvements.
